CBS | Transcript: National security adviser Jake Sullivan on "Face the Nation", 25 Sep "busy man watching the world"
...MARGARET BRENNAN: Vladimir Putin will carry out this annexation of eastern Ukraine within the next few days. If Russia is expanding its NUCLEAR UMBRELLA over this part of the country. Does that put the US in more direct conflict with Russia? And does a nuclear weapon being used there, p-put Russia in conflict directly with the US and NATO?
JAKE SULLIVAN: We have been crystal clear up to and including President Biden that we will not recognize the sham referenda, they in no way represent the will of the Ukrainian people. And we will treat this territory for what it is - Ukrainian territory, not Russian territory. And we will continue to support the Ukrainians as they seek to de[-]occupy this territory. So we've been clear, we're not going to stop or slow down our support to the Ukrainians, no matter what Putin tries to do with these-these fake elections and fake referenda and annexation. Now, when it comes to the question of nuclear use, President Putin's been waving around the nuclear card < wipes tears > at various points through this conflict the last few days are not the first time-
BRENNAN: -But he hasn't been as cornered as he is now.
SULLIVAN: It's true, and it is a matter that we have to take deadly seriously because it is a matter of paramount seriousness - the possible use of NUCLEAR WEAPONS for the first time since the Second World War [August 1945]. We have communicated directly, privately, at very high levels to the Kremlin, that any use of NUCLEAR WEAPONS will be met with catastrophic consequences for Russia, that the United States in our allies will respond decisively. And we have been clear and specific about what that will entail. We have, in public, been equally clear, as a matter of principle, that the United States will respond decisively if Russia uses NUCLEAR WEAPONS and that we will continue to support Ukraine in its efforts to defend its country and defend its democracy.
BRENNAN: Russia has been talking about this power plant rather than NUCLEAR WEAPONS just for the past 24 hours. Where does that fall? Is this an escalating threat?
SULLIVAN: So, for your viewers, there is a nuclear power plant < wipes tears > that is in Russian occupied portions of Ukraine. It has been put into cold shutdown to make it less likely that there's some kind of catastrophic incident at the plant. It is actually still being operated by the Ukrainian operators who are essentially at GUNPOINT from the Russian occupying forces. And the Russians have been consistently implying that there may be some kind of accident at this plant. ...
